How to Integrate Microsoft IIS SMTP into the Email Data Model

Has anyone successfully integrated a Microsoft IIS SMTP server into Splunk? The logs the service creates are steps in a transaction rather than individual entries for actual emails sent. I wanted to normalize the log source to feed into the Email data model, but the logs are such a mess I am considering just deploying a different email relay that has better logging.

I'd be particularly interested to know how to create single events that represent a sent email from the 10 or so individual rows that represent an email transaction. I realize you can use the transaction command, but I need an actual row to feed into a data model that can be accelerated.

What most people do is create a summary index and then use a populating search to create aggregate events based on MID values and then use those events.
